Here are some basic answers. Card Materials The majority of plastic cards in circulation today are made of polyvinyl chloride. PVC plastic is the world's most widely produced and is very profitable to produce. The substance is made by exposing chloride vinyl for a polymerization process that allows molecules to create networks or long chains that are very strong. The PVC resin resulting powder is heated and rolled into sheets that are then die punched into individual cards. Pigments can be added to the mixture during heating process to create different colored cards. Card varieties Layers of Mylar, paper, or adhesive in May added as a final step for use in different applications. Maps can also be implemented either a matte or slick to suit different styles of printing. Composite maps have a polyester core laminated between two sheets of PVC to give them strength. They are more expensive than ordinary cards, but can withstand more abuse. Cards Friends of the Earth recycled PVC are now available from distributors environmentally conscious. In addition to choosing this option you can also increase sustainability by collecting cards obsolete your business and turn them in for recycling. Just not mix with other types of PVC plastic which must undergo a process of recovery different. Thermal Printing The most common type of ID card printing heat transfer is simple using one type of resin-based ink. Ribbons Coated ink run through a card printer and are pressed against the surface of each card or sheet of transfer. The printhead is heated to release the ink ribbon on the print area where it bonds tightly with the surface of the creation of a result smudge proof. Ribbons are usually formatted in a coil-coil design and ink is contained in the repeating segments yellow, magenta, cyan and black. These colors are applied in layers one after the other to create a high quality replica of a photograph or image complex one. Plain black ribbons are available for simple jobs that do not require color. Magnetic stripe encoding The black or "HiCo" magnetic strip on the back of many cards is made of plastic with a mixture of iron oxide powder. A powerful electromagnet locks metal particles in opposing directions and different sequences in the plastic. This creates a binary code - the same type using computers to operate. When the card is swiped through a reader, these particles are briefly reactivated so that coded information can be retrieved. "Loco" tapes that do not require an intense magnetic field in the program are also available, but this variety is more susceptible to accidental erasure.
